Hudson, MI – Hudson Area Schools Superintendent Dr. Michael Osborne reported in a statement issued on the school’s website that they have stopped in-person classes.

Remote instruction will begin Thursday, October 22nd. All activities and events such as sports and conferences will continue as scheduled unless informed otherwise.

The district is having difficulty staffing for almost every employee group, as they have several staff that are on quarantine.

Remote learning will continue through Friday, October 30th. The plan is to begin in-person instruction again on Monday, November 2nd.
